Photo submitted to the Times Observer Places at competition Larry Ahn, a student of Kimio Nelson’s Fighting Tigers Martial Arts competed at the Lake Erie Open held Sept. 27 in Cambridge Springs. Ahn placed second in fighting and second in forms in the event hosted by the Edinboro Family Martial Arts Center.

Youth soccer The Kinzua U-12 soccer team shut out visiting Oil Region/Titusville, 12-0, on Sunday. For Kinzua, Tristan Boger scored three goals, Kennedy Cratty scored two goals and had one assist, Graham Johnson and Kathryn Lobdell each scored two goals, Steffen Blair scored one goal and had three assists, Joshua Eernisse scored one goal and had one assist, Julie Jameson scored one goal, and Ashley Barker had an assist. Eernisse and Jason Tipton shared goalie duties for the shutout. J.V. cross Youngsville’s Ryan Pepper was 35th in 20:47 in the junior varsity cross country race at the Dirty Dawg Invitational Saturday at Harbor Creek High School. Teammate Josh Lewis was 37th in 20:53, Derek Wachter 52nd in 22:15 and Jacob Gambino 66th in 24:27. Eisenhower’s Jordan Quiggle finished in 23:42. Park Avenue Motor Car defeated Ameriprise No. 2 in a sudden death playoff for the overall 2008 championship in the Tuesday Night Golf League at Jackson Valley Country Club.
